Hikoki is actually lighter weight than Milwaukee. You probably looked at Hikoki with batteries and nails and M18 empty (no battery or nails). New Makita will be between in weight but with a longer magazine than Hikoki and hopefully better balanced so it may end up being the sweet spot with current technology. Even the new Dewalt flywheel is now about the same weight. The prior version Dewalt was noticably lighter, but lacks power and reliability. Paslode is now the only one of the 4 that is noticably lighter (but lacks power and is less convenient with the gas and maintenance). I'm fairly certain Milwaukee is the heaviest but most powerful, unless the new Makita matches it.

I'm not a framer so not using it as often as a chippy but as a steely still use it quite a lot because most of the time end up having to do the framers job because some framers don't set their pockets for the steel right or if it's pre-fab the pockets are usually wrong. I haven't had an issue with misfiring for a long time, I used to have to hold the rack too and a bit of wd-40 used to get it going again but the gun is quite old now and doesn't really misfire at all, maybe these guns just need a bit of wearing in. The battery is annoying too, when it shows 2 bars but is nearly dead is a pain in the ass. I'm happy with the gun, I don't recommend it, though, I get apprentices ask about it all the time and I usually say go with Paslode or Milwaukee if you really want to go battery, the Milwaukee are weighted not the best but overall they shoot better and you can skew far easier because the tip on the Hikoki is much to be desired.
